作为一名长期从事电源设计的工程师,我深知电源使能信号设计对系统可靠性的关键影响。RTQ6362的EN/UVLO功能设计看似简单,实则暗藏玄机。这个功能模块本质上是一个带滞回特性的电压监测器,通过精确控制电源的启停阈值来保护后级电路。
在实际项目中,我遇到过不少因为EN引脚设计不当导致的系统故障。最典型的就是锂电池供电场景下,由于没有正确设置滞回电压,系统在临界电压点反复重启,最终导致MCU程序跑飞。这也让我深刻认识到,好的EN/UVLO设计不仅要考虑理论计算,更要结合实际应用场景。
RTQ6362的EN引脚内部结构值得深入研究。其核心是一个带滞回的比较器电路,但与其他芯片不同的是,它集成了两个精密电流源。这种设计带来了几个独特优势:
在实际layout时,我发现EN引脚的ESD保护二极管漏电流会影响阈值精度。建议在高温环境下测试时,预留5%的设计余量。
建立准确的电路模型是设计的基础。我们可以将EN引脚的外部电路等效为:
code复制VIN ---[R93]---+---[R92]---GND
|
EN
这个看似简单的分压网络,实际上需要考虑三个工作状态:
通过基尔霍夫电流定律,我们可以推导出两组关键方程:
停止电压方程(下降沿):
VTH_EN = (VStop × R92)/(R92 + R93) - IEN × R92
启动电压方程(上升沿):
VTH_EN = (VStart × R92)/(R92 + R93) - IEN_Hys × R92
这两个方程构成了我们设计的基础框架。在实际应用中,我发现电阻的温漂特性会影响方程精度,特别是当使用大阻值电阻时(>1MΩ),建议选择低温漂系数的厚膜电阻。
以10串三元锂电池系统为例,我们需要设定合理的启停阈值:
这个设计要解决的核心问题是:防止电池过放的同时,避免输入电压波动导致系统频繁重启。
步骤1:确定总电阻值
根据滞回公式:
Rtotal = (VStart - VStop)/(IEN_Hys - IEN)
= (32V - 30V)/(2.9μA - 0.9μA)
= 1MΩ
这里有个设计技巧:总电阻不宜过大,否则漏电流会影响精度;也不宜过小,否则功耗会增加。1MΩ是个比较折中的选择。
步骤2:计算R92值
代入停止电压方程:
R92 = (VTH_EN × Rtotal)/(VStop - IEN × Rtotal)
= (1.25V × 1MΩ)/(30V - 0.9μA × 1MΩ)
≈ 42.96kΩ
步骤3:计算R93值
R93 = Rtotal - R92 = 1MΩ - 42.96kΩ ≈ 957.04kΩ
步骤4:标准电阻选型
考虑到实际采购便利性,我们选择:
这种组合的误差仅0.09%,完全满足设计要求。
使用标准电阻值后,我们需要重新验证关键参数:
停止电压验证:
VStop = (1.25V + 0.9μA × 43kΩ) × (1MΩ/43kΩ) ≈ 29.97V
启动电压验证:
VStart = (1.25V + 2.9μA × 43kΩ) × (1MΩ/43kΩ) ≈ 31.97V
实测数据与理论计算非常吻合,证明我们的设计是可靠的。
在实际工程中,电阻的选择需要考虑多个因素:
| 参数 | 建议值 | 理由 |
|---|---|---|
| 精度 | ±1%或更好 | 确保阈值精度 |
| 封装 | 0603 | 满足功耗要求,便于布局 |
| 材质 | 厚膜电阻 | 温度稳定性好 |
| 额定功率 | 1/10W | 裕量充足(计算功耗约1mW) |
特别提醒:避免使用0805及以上封装,过大的焊盘可能引入寄生电容,影响EN引脚响应速度。
VTH_EN的工艺波动(1.15V-1.36V)会显著影响阈值电压。我们做了全面分析:
| VTH_EN | VStop | VStart | 风险评估 |
|---|---|---|---|
| 1.15V | 27.65V | 29.64V | 存在过放风险 |
| 1.25V | 29.97V | 31.97V | 理想工作点 |
| 1.36V | 32.53V | 34.53V | 可能过早切断供电 |
对于高可靠性要求的应用,建议采用"保守型设计"方法:
这样即使在最坏情况下,VStop也能保证≥30V。
良好的布局可以避免很多后期问题:
一个常见的错误是将分压电阻放在远离芯片的位置,这会导致EN引脚容易受到干扰,出现误动作。
在电池供电系统中,UVLO需要与BMS配合工作:
有BMS的场景:
无BMS的场景:
根据我的调试经验,EN/UVLO电路的常见问题包括:
问题1:阈值偏差大
问题2:频繁启停
问题3:无法启动
一个实用的调试技巧:用可调电源缓慢升高输入电压,用示波器同时监测VIN和EN引脚电压,可以清晰观察到启动过程。
对于输入电压波动较大的应用,可以考虑动态调节滞回电压:
这种方法可以实现:
在宽温范围应用中,需要考虑温度影响:
对于-40℃到+85℃的应用,建议:
对于复杂系统,可以采用多级UVLO策略:
这种分级设计可以确保系统有序关机,避免突然断电导致数据丢失。
经过多个项目的验证,我总结了一些实测数据:
| 参数 | 计算值 | 实测平均值 | 偏差 |
|---|---|---|---|
| VStop | 29.97V | 30.1V | +0.4% |
| VStart | 31.97V | 32.2V | +0.7% |
| 滞回电压 | 2.0V | 2.1V | +5% |
| 响应时间 | - | 120μs | - |
基于这些数据,给出以下优化建议:
一个容易忽视的问题是长期可靠性。在潮湿环境中,高阻值电阻容易受潮导致阻值变化。建议在电阻表面涂覆三防漆,或者选择玻璃釉封装的电阻。